zielen/ˈt͡siːlən/to aim; to take aim
zielen is a German verb that means to aim or to take aim. It is pronounced /ˈt͡siːlən/. In conjugation, the simple past is "zielte" and the past participle is "gezielt".
Definitions
1.to direct an action or object toward a target(shooting, throwing, general)
a.to point a weapon, object, or action toward something
Der Schütze beginnt zu zielen, bevor er abdrückt.—The shooter starts to aim before pulling the trigger.
b.to intend or try to achieve something; to target an outcome
Die Kampagne zielt auf junge Erwachsene ab.—The campaign targets young adults.
Conjugation
| Infinitive | zielen |
|---|---|
| Present (ich) | ziele |
| Present (du) | zielst |
| Present (er/sie/es) | zielt |
| Preterite (ich) | zielte |
| Participle II | gezielt |
| Konjunktiv II (ich) | zielte |
| Imperative (singular) | ziele |
| Imperative (plural) | zielt |
| Auxiliary | haben |
